WebHowever, ammonia has the disadvantages of slow laminar flame speed, high ignition energy and narrow ignition limit. And the high potential of fuel-NOx emission is also an urgent problem to be solved for ammonia. In order to improve the combustion rate, ammonia can be mixed with other highly active compounds as additives. WebDec 24, 2024 · Laminar flame speed decreased up to 18% when increasing RH from 0 to 1, which can exacerbate the problem of ammonia flame stability. This decrease in the flame laminar speed was found to be similar for various equivalence and compression ratios.
